  • Alert Items

    • If you have changed marital status, had an ownership or rental change, added land, or made any other changes to your operation it is important that you give us the information so that we can update your records otherwise it could adversely affect your insurable interest.  

    • Land not planted and harvested in one of the three previous crop years needs a written agreement to be insurable (land broken right after CRP is one exception as CRP is considered a crop rotation).

    • July 11, 2008 the RMA announced that there will be the following policy change for 2009:  There will be a termination of the GRP Rangeland Pilot Crop Insurance Program.  The RMA recently received budgetary approval to implement the Pasture Rangeland Forage (PRF) Rainfall Index pilot insurance program for Montana, and plans to do so for the 2009 crop year. Program materials should be released within the next few weeks.  It is anticipated that everyone in Montana that wants Rangeland coverage will have to shift to the new program which would cover rangeland as well as hay land with the insured being able to pick and choose what acres they want to cover.  Cancellation notices will probably be issued about 30 days prior to September 30th.  Producers have until November 30th to sign up for the new Pasture Rangeland and Forage Policy.
